Répartition et équilibrage de charges dans les hôtes mobiles.

Loading...
Thumbnail Image

Date

2011

Journal Title

Journal ISSN

Volume Title

Publisher

Université Mouloud Mammeri

Abstract

L'évolution rapide des capacités de traitement des nœuds mobiles et l'amélioration de la qualité du réseau reliant ces entités ont motive l'utilisation du réseau ad hoc comme sup- port pour les calculs distribues. Une bonne utilisation de cette plate-forme permet ainsi d'augmenter la puissance potentielle des nœuds. La recherche d'un maximum de puis- sance nécessite une répartition et un équilibrage de charges efficace. Ceci est d'autant plus vrai lorsque l'on se trouve dans un contexte hétérogène. En effet, les ordinateurs mobiles possèdent des ressources intrinsèques (puissance de calcul, autonomie de la batterie) de ca pacites très variables, pouvant varier de ressources comparables à celles des PC, notamment dans le cas des ordinateurs portables, jusqu'à des ressources nettement inférieures, notamment dans le cas des ordinateurs de poche. Cette hétérogénéité de capacité de traitement peut engendrer des situations ou des nœuds sont fortement charges, tandis que d'autres restent faiblement charges ou inutilisés. Une bonne utilisation de chaque nœud L'évolution rapide des capacités de traitement des nœuds mobiles et l'amélioration de la qualité du réseau reliant ces entités ont motive l'utilisation du réseau ad hoc comme sup- port pour les calculs distribués. Une bonne utilisation de cette plate-forme permet ainsi d'augmenter la puissance potentielle des nœuds. La recherche d'un maximum de puis- sance nécessite une répartition et un équilibrage de charges efficace. Ceci est d'autant plus vrai lorsque l'on se trouve dans un contexte hétérogène. En effet, les ordinateurs mobiles possèdent des ressources intrinsèques (puissance de calcul, autonomie de la batterie) de ca- pacités trµes variables, pouvant varier de ressources comparables a celles des PC, notamment dans le cas des ordinateurs portables, jusqu'à des ressources nettement inférieures, notam- ment dans le cas des ordinateurs de poche. Cette hétérogéneite de capacité de traitement peut engendrer des situations ou des nœuds sont fortement charges, tandis que d'autres restent faiblement charges ou inutilisés. Une bonne utilisation de chaque nœud permet de pro¯ter de sa puissance sans affecter ses propres travaux et d'augmenter potentiellement la puissance des nœuds mobiles. Dans ce travail, nous proposons une nouvelle approche d'équilibrage de charges ou les noeuds les moins charges " aidant " les noeuds trop chargés. La stratégie proposée est basée sur les algorithmes de clustering ou la prise de décision s'effectue en fonction de la charge moyenne des clusters, ce qui permet de réduire les échanges d'information. L'objectif du travail présenté est d'assurer la plus grande longévité possible d'un réseau ad hoc et de réduire les temps d'exécution des applications. Chaque nœud étant en charge d'un certain nombre de taches, réduire les temps d'exécution et la consommation énergétique d'un nœud revient donc à partager sa charge de travail avec ses voisins les moins chargés. L'idée est de faire en sorte que la charge à transférer de chaque nœud soit proportionnelle à la puissance de traitement et le niveau d'énergie restant du nœud acceptant cette charge.d permet de proter de sa puissance sans a®ecter ses propres travaux et d'augmenter potentiellement la puissance des noeuds mobiles. Dans ce travail, nous proposons une nouvelle approche d'équilibrage de charges ou les noeuds les moins charges " aidant " les noeuds trop charges. La stratégie proposée est basée sur les algorithmes de clustering ou la prise de décision s'e®ectue en fonction de la charge moyenne des clusters, ce qui permet de réduire les échanges d'information. L'objectif du travail présente est d'assurer la plus grande longevite possible d'un réseau ad hoc et de réduire les temps d'exécution des applications. Chaque nœud étant en charge d'un certain nombre de t^aches, réduire les temps d'exécution et la consommation énergétique d'un nœud revient donc à partager sa charge de travail avec ses voisins les moins charges. L'idée est de faire en sorte que la charge à transférer de chaque nœud soit proportionnelle à la puissance de traitement et le niveau d'énergie restant du nœud acceptant cette charge.

Description

94 f. ill,; 30cm . (+CD- Rom)

Keywords

Equilibrage de charges, Clustering, Réseaux ad Hoc, Coolaboration dans les réseaux ad Hoc, Conservation d'énergie

Citation

Informatique